🌿 Why Morning Nature Sounds?
Nature has its own rhythm — and the garden at sunrise is one of its most tender expressions. Listening to early morning sounds can:
Helpreduce cortisoland ground the nervous system before daily stress kicks in
Encourage presence and mindfulness, setting a peaceful tone for the day
Serve as anatural alarm clock alternativethat wakes you gradually
Improve mood and focusthrough exposure to non-verbal, natural soundscapes
Provide amental resetfor those waking from troubled or shallow sleep
Birdsong, in particular, is neurologically linked to a sense ofsafety and aliveness— making it one of the most beneficial sounds to hear upon waking.
